Rotherham(i)
6 Then, shall leap as a hart, the lame, Then, shall shout, the tongue of the dumb, For, there have broken forth––In the desert––waters, And, streams, in, the waste plain:
7 Then shall, the glowing sand, become, a lake, And, thirsty ground––springs of water,––In the home of the wild dog––its lair, Shall be an enclosure for cane and paper–reed.
8 And there shall be, there, a raised way–even, a high road, And, the Highroad of Holiness, shall it be called, There shall not pass over it one who is unclean; But, He Himself, shall be one of them, travelling the road, And, the perverse, shall not stray [thereinto].
